>Does anyone have any constructive thoughts on how to encourage non >members to participate in the chapter? 

The best draw would be a technical. I'd suggest something fairly basic such as efficient pitch raising or upright regulation. A lunch may be in order, too. Consider charging a nominal amount. Free technicals can be poorly attended but, if you stick a monetary figure to it, prospects consider it as "something worthwhile attending".
